Problem

Complex interactive graphical designs require seamless collaboration among diverse stakeholders, but existing design tools often fail to facilitate a fluid and frictionless flow of information, especially across geographically dispersed teams, limiting effective communication and coordination.

Innovation Solution

A graphical design environment with a drag-and-drop interface, note interface, and discussion interface that allows users to add and manage notes and comments, which are stored in a data store and delivered via email, enabling stakeholders to collaborate on interactive graphical designs by linking notes to widgets and allowing comments to be added and viewed in a design player.

AI summary

Various methods and systems for collaborating on the specification of an interactive graphical design are provided. An exemplary system comprises a graphical design environment. The system also comprises a note interface in the graphical design environment that displays a note field for accepting a text string from the user. The system also comprises a design player that renders the design. The system also comprises a discussion interface that: (i) is displayed in the design player consistently with the design; (ii) displays the text string from the user as a note; and (iii) accepts a comment from a second user regarding the note. The system also comprises a data store accessible to the graphical design environment and the design player. The comment is displayed in the graphical design environment after being accepted in the discussion interface.
